A Design Rooted in Heritage
As I gazed up at the tower, I was struck by its architectural beauty, rooted deeply in Korea’s cultural heritage. The design pays homage to the Dabotap Pagoda from Gyeongju’s Bulguksa Temple, a nod to the country’s storied past. The anticipation built as I rode the high-speed elevator to the observation deck, where a breathtaking vista awaited:
- The bustling Busan Port and the serene Yeongdo Island
- The sprawling Democracy Park
- The striking Yeongdodaegyo and Busandaegyo bridges
- The vibrant Jagalchi Market
- The distant Oryukdo Islands
On particularly clear days, even the elusive Daemado Islands come into view, offering a photographer’s paradise.

Must-Visit Nearby Attractions
Exploring Yongdusan Park offered even more treasures:
- The imposing Statue of the Great Admiral Yi Sun-sin
- The resonant Bell of the Citizens
- A charming flower clock that adds a splash of color
- The inspiring bust of independence activist Baeksan An Hee-je
Just a short walk or drive from the tower:
- BIFF Square, a 15-minute stroll away, buzzes with street food and film culture
- The quirky Gamcheon Culture Village, just a 15-minute drive, known as “Korea’s Santorini”
- Gukje Market, a mere 15-minute walk, one of Korea’s largest traditional markets
- Jagalchi Fish Market, a 20-minute walk, the ultimate seafood haven

Insider Tips for Visiting
- Location: Yongdusan Park, Jung-gu, Busan
- Height: 120 meters
- Built: 1973
- Purpose: Entertainment and tourism
- Best time to visit: As the sun sets, for breathtaking night views
